Olympia Events is more than an exhibition venue, conference centre and live-event space - it's an inspiration.
Against a backdrop of grand Victorian architecture, the seven connected spaces inspire engagement and enjoyment.
Olympia Events is recognised in the industry for exceptional levels of customer service and support, and our numerous awards are testament to our clients' satisfaction.
Beyond the walls of our venue, Olympia is on the ground, working to invest in people, strengthen our communities, and protect the environment.
Olympia Events is undergoing a period of change.
In 2017, the venue was bought by a consortium led by Yoo Capital and Deutsche Finance international.
Work is currently underway to transform the wider estate into a cultural hub of which Olympia Events will be the central part.

Role: The Restaurant Manager will play a pivotal role in shaping the guest experience and operational success of The Addison, a world-class live music venue and hospitality destination at Olympia.
We are seeking a highly driven hospitality leader with a passion for exceptional service, a strong understanding of London's dynamic restaurant landscape, and the ability to create experiences that guests remember and return for.
Leading from the floor, you will inspire a culture of excellence, energy and genuine hospitality, ensuring every service is delivered to the highest standards.
You will combine operational expertise with commercial awareness and a relentless focus on guest satisfaction, continually seeking opportunities to elevate the dining experience, challenge convention and differentiate The Addison from its competitors.
Through your leadership, creativity and attention to detail, you will help establish The Addison as one of London's most exciting food and beverage destinations.
As a hands-on leader, you will manage daily floor operations, drive exceptional guest experience, and inspire a high-performing team to deliver refined yet vibrant service.
